1. Introduction:
In industries such as marine engineering, offshore oil & gas, and desalination plants, corrosion remains one of the most costly and persistent problems. Saline environments, fluctuating pressures, and varying temperatures make it difficult for standard metal alloys to maintain durability and structural integrity over time. Conventional flanges often fall short in resisting seawater corrosion, biofouling, and erosion, leading to frequent maintenance, system downtime, and high replacement costs.
2. Product Introduction:
Copper Nickel 90/10 Flanges are precision-engineered pipe connection components made from an alloy comprising 90% copper and 10% nickel, often with small additions of iron and manganese to enhance corrosion resistance. Manufactured to meet international standards like ASTM B122 and ASME SB122, these flanges are trusted components in systems exposed to harsh environments, particularly seawater.

4. Real-Life Applications: Where Are They Used?
???? Marine piping systems for seawater cooling, firefighting, and bilge systems
⚓ Offshore oil platforms and naval vessels
???? Desalination plants and brine filtration systems
???? Chemical and petrochemical processing units
???? Heat exchangers and condenser systems
????️ Infrastructure in coastal or high-humidity regions
Their proven reliability across these sectors has cemented their role in critical infrastructure worldwide.
